У меня есть фрейм данных временного ряда.Я заинтересован в построении кумулятивных сумм по времени по группам [column1, column2].До сих пор я могу построить суммарную сумму только в тех точках, где существовала групповая комбинация.То, что я хочу, это кумулятивная сумма для каждой группы на каждой временной отметке в исходном фрейме данных, так что я могу легко построить общую кумулятивную сумму на том же графике, что и кумулятивные суммы группы.
[РЕДАКТИРОВАТЬ] Я получилэто работает, делая это для каждой интересующей меня группы:
values = np.where((df.column1==someVal) & (df.column2==someVal), df.column3, 0).cumsum()
plt.plot(df.timestamp, values)